Prince George will carry a ceremonial sword at King Charles III’s coronation in May as a traditional representation of him acting as a protector of his grandfather. The nine-year-old is second-in-line to the throne and will hold a small ceremonial sword in his role as the Page of Honour. WebSep 15, 2013 · 15 September 2013 A number of days—between 10 and 16, after a person has “Reached the Abode of Siva,” a special ceremony called a Kariyam is performed. Tamil tradition requires people to avoid saying that a person is dead.
